Enhancing Sales for Special Occasions
Promotions during holidays like Father’s Day can significantly drive your online sales. Here are four tips to maximize your store’s potential during these events:
1. Offer Personalized Gift Options
Personalization has become a powerful tool in e-commerce. For Father's Day, offer products that can be customized. This could be engraving names on items, offering custom gift sets, or even personalized product recommendations based on past purchases. Personalization increases perceived value and strengthens customer relationships.
2. Run Exclusive Time-Limited Offers
Create a sense of urgency with time-bound offers. Limited-time discounts or exclusive bundles for Father’s Day can encourage quick buying decisions. Promote these offers through your email list and social media to reach a broader audience.
3. Optimize Your Product Listings
Ensure that your product listings are optimized for Father’s Day. This includes adding relevant keywords, updating product descriptions to highlight their suitability as gifts, and using high-quality images that capture the essence of Father’s Day. This not only improves visibility but also amplifies the appeal of your products.
4. Leverage Email Marketing
Segregate your email list and send targeted campaigns highlighting your Father’s Day deals. Personal touches, like addressing recipients by their name and suggesting products based on their past purchases, can increase open rates and conversions.
Mastering the Coffee Niche: A Case Study
A dropshipping store in the coffee niche has proven that dedication to quality and niche specificity can lead to impressive sales figures. By tapping into the coffee culture's vibrant community, this store generated over $20,000 monthly. Let’s explore how they did it and how you can replicate their success.
Product Selection
Choose high-demand, quality products that resonate with coffee enthusiasts. This store offered a diverse range, from gourmet beans to unique brewing equipment, ensuring that there was something for every type of coffee lover.
Engaging Content Marketing
Creating engaging content is crucial. This store ran a blog featuring coffee brewing tips, recipes, and the latest trends in the coffee world. Regular content updates engaged their audience and drove consistent traffic to their store.
Utilizing Influencer Marketing
Partnering with popular coffee influencers helped boost credibility and reach. Influencers reviewed their products, which led to authentic testimonials and wider audience exposure.
Offering Subscription Services
To ensure continuous revenue, they introduced a subscription service for regular coffee deliveries. This not only secured repeat customers but also created a community of loyal buyers.
Creating Stunning Video Ads
Video advertising is a game-changer for dropshipping products. Here’s how to create compelling video ads that capture attention and drive sales:
Crafting a Captivating Story
Your video ad should tell a story that resonates with your target audience. This could be demonstrating how your product solves a problem, sharing customer testimonials, or showing the product in use.
High-Quality Production
Invest in good production quality. Even if you’re on a budget, ensure clear visuals, good lighting, and crisp sound. Poor quality can turn potential customers away.
Call to Action
Every video ad should have a strong call to action (CTA). Whether it's "Shop Now," "Learn More," or "Order Today," a clear CTA guides viewers toward the next step.
A/B Testing
Run A/B tests with different versions of your video ads to see which performs better. This can involve changing elements such as the opening hook, the CTA, or the background music. Analyze the results and optimize accordingly.
Measuring Marketing Performance
Performance, measurement, and attribution are crucial for successful marketing, especially with the devaluation of third-party cookies. Here's how to stay ahead:
Analytics Tools
Use comprehensive analytics tools to track your marketing campaigns. Google Analytics, for instance, can provide insights into your traffic sources, user behavior, and conversion rates.
Performance-Driven Paid Media
Nearly half of retail marketers prioritize performance-driven paid media. Invest in PPC (Pay-Per-Click) and SEM (Search Engine Marketing) campaigns that can be tailored to your target audience and budget, ensuring every dollar spent is maximized for ROI.
Attribution Models
Implement attribution models to understand which marketing channels or touchpoints are driving the most conversions. This helps in allocating your budget more effectively and making data-driven decisions.
Continuous Learning and Optimizing
The e-commerce landscape is dynamic. Stay updated with the latest trends, tools, and best practices. Regularly review and refine your strategies based on the performance data to stay competitive.
